CTS Dallas and Phoenix Labs successfully implemented WNV NAT testing on the Panther Testing Platform on Monday, June 17th. As previously communicated, the Grifols assay and sample requirements are the same, and the package insert has been modified to state the assay is specific to the Panther Testing Platform. The new package insert, assay history list, and platform history list are now available on our website.
